The Ennerdale Country House Hotel

Main Street, Cleator, Cleator (Nr Cockermouth)

A delightful Grade Two listed building located in the quiet corner of the Western Lake District. All rooms have been refurbished to a very high standard and incorporate entertainment systems of Playstation, CD player and Video Recorders. The hotel has a wide range of accommodation including 4 four poster rooms 3 with Spa baths. Enjoy Breathtaking scenery on our doorstep or for the more energetic the coast to coast walk is just outside our front door. Other local attractions are Muncaster Castle, The Western Lakes and Fells and the Ravenglass and Eskdale Narrow Gauge Railway are all in easy drive of the hotel.

Directions to The Ennerdale Country House Hotel

Junction 40 M6 Penrith, take A66 to Cockermouth, at roundabout leading to Cockermouth take left hand exit on A5086 to Egremont. Follow road for approximately 20 minutes through Cleator and Cleator Moor, Hotel on the left hand side coming out of Cleator
